In Situ

1/11/2024

 
Picture
Inanimate objects carry the vibration of their maker. I am extremely cognizant the emotions I infuse into my work can, indeed, be sensed by those who experience it. While some may dismiss this as mere sentimentality, I steadfastly believe in its authenticity. Our surroundings shape who we are. As a creator, my goal is to harmonize with my creations, ensuring that those who engage with my work, particularly those who share their space with it, reap the benefits. I express sincere gratitude to both business and private collectors who choose to invest in my work.

Honoring Dad Through Art

1/7/2024

 
Picture
TITLE: Every Step I Take Is My Home
MEDIUM: Mixed Media
SIZE: 48” x 36”

Zoom in. Notice the footprints? Crafted as a tribute to my late father, this piece began with layers taken from a road atlas he cherished throughout the years. An avid enthusiast of cars, driving, and road trips, my dad's passion became the inspiration.

When a loved one passes, what do you do with their belongings? Rooted in creativity, spirituality, and resourcefulness, my process naturally involves incorporating these remnants into my artwork. Yet, the road map layers felt incomplete. To enhance the piece, I added a subsequent layer of plaster and paint, imprinting my own footprints to symbolize the places my father and I journeyed together throughout his lifetime.

New Sculptural Works

1/4/2024

 
Picture
Press Feature!

Watch the full story:
​​https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=gLXgvJH-fu0&t=1s

"Where is home? Not a simple question for someone who's moved again and again and again. From Brazil, to Canada, to the States, Samantha da Silva has moved almost 40 times - at first to find a better life, then sometimes because of metaphorical volcanoes, and once, a real one. In 2018 lava chased her and her husband from their Hawaii home. 


When change is the only constant, sometimes you need something else to count on. da Silva found it here: Her art is abstract, but is often infused with a very concrete sense of place.

So knowing the ground may once again move beneath her feet, she moves ahead with a sense of urgency to appreciate the here and now. No matter where in the world Samantha da Silva is, right now, this is home." Peter Rosen, KSL News
